In a strange and sinister circus, Ace finds herself confronted by her deepest fears, as clowns and other performers weave a tapestry of oddities and mysteries. With her apprehension about clowns looming large, she is reluctantly pulled into the Doctor’s ambitious plan to enter a talent contest that promises glory—but at what cost? As the eccentric characters come to life, the line between entertainment and danger blurs, creating a chilling atmosphere where the stakes are unexpectedly high.
The vibrant yet eerie backdrop of the circus becomes a battleground for the Doctor's wit and charm against the malevolent forces lurking behind the curtain. Each act unravels additional layers of intrigue, testing Ace’s resolve and courage as she navigates through unexpected twists and dark secrets hidden within the show's spectacle. Together, they must outsmart their adversaries, confront fears, and ultimately redefine what it means to be a performer in a world where reality and illusion intertwine.
